- The distance between Dedza, Malawi and Lake Tekapo, New Zealand is approximately 12,158 km or 7,555 mi.
- To reach Dedza in this distance one would set out from Lake Tekapo bearing 225.3° or SW and follow the great circles arc to approach Dedza bearing 328.2° or NNW .
- Dedza has a subtropical highland climate with dry winters (Cwb) whereas Lake Tekapo has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Dedza is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as Lake Tekapo is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The average temperature is 8.3 °C (15°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.1 °C (12.8°F) less in Dedza.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 499.2 mm (19.7 in) more which is equivalent to 499.2 l/m² (12.25 US gal/ft²) or 4,992,000 l/ha (533,678 US gal/ac) more. About 1 4/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 25.9° higher in Dedza than in Lake Tekapo.
